Output 63e9b2490c98c6dca4c1eaf84a0795bccd6e6e5f056bf156377648aa2af70d57:22

value
21223013
script pubkey
OP_0 OP_PUSHBYTES_20 39815ec701667b4b52c7e4494ff5986ce47fde7b
address
bc1q8xq4a3cpvea5k5k8u3y5lavcdnj8lhnmkqugmt
transaction
63e9b2490c98c6dca4c1eaf84a0795bccd6e6e5f056bf156377648aa2af70d57
spent
true